Yes, it's cheetahs. Light blue is their former range, the darker shades of blue correlate to their population densities in their remaining range. The poor Asiatic cheetah is nearly extinct, only maybe a hundred left running around in central Iran :(

If anyone's curious, unlike lions whose former range really does cover the Americas, the extinct American cheetah wasn't related to the African counterpart, but was a product of convergent evolution. Their closest relative was the cougar.
